Establishing Up Monitoring Code



To harness the complete potential of Google Analytics, establishing the monitoring code correctly is an essential step. The tracking code, a bit of JavaScript, makes it possible for Google Analytics to collect data about customer communications on your website. To start, log in to your Google Analytics account and browse to the Admin section. Under the Residential or commercial property column, select "Monitoring Details" and then "Monitoring Code." Here, you will certainly find your unique tracking ID, which starts with "UA-" complied with by a collection of numbers.


Following, you'll require to embed this code into the HTML of your internet site. Ideally, position the tracking code just prior to the closing tag on every web page you wish to check. Take into consideration utilizing plugins that promote simple integration. if you're utilizing a material administration system (CMS) like WordPress.


After implementing the code, it's crucial to validate its functionality. Make use of the "Real-Time" records in Google Analytics to confirm that data is being accumulated as anticipated. By making certain appropriate configuration, you produce a solid structure for effective information analysis and tactical decision-making to boost your website's efficiency.




Key Metrics to Monitor



Regularly checking crucial metrics in Google Analytics is essential for examining your internet site's performance and user engagement. Among the essential metrics to track are page views, which offer understanding right into how commonly users check out various pages on your website. Furthermore, unique visitors aid you recognize the reach of your content by showing the number of unique customers are engaging with your website over an offered period.


Bounce price is another essential metric, disclosing the percentage of visitors that leave your site after watching only one page. A high bounce price might signal concerns with content significance or customer experience. On the other hand, session duration indicates the length of time visitors remain on your website, assisting you gauge web content efficiency and individual rate of interest.
